Applicants planning to enter Canada need to submit an online application with the required set of documents. If travelling as a family, then each family member, including children under the age of 18, must fill out a separate application. The list of documents one needs to submit with a visa application includes:
- • Proof of vaccination, and negative COVID-19 test result (taken within 72 hours of departure)
- • ArriveCAN receipt (electronic or paper)
- • A valid passport with an expiry date that is after six months or more.
- • Documents that prove you have enough ties to your home country.
- • Purpose of Travel, and a Letter of Invitation (from friend, or family member)
- • Travel Itinerary
- • Proof of funds to support your visit
Depending on their country of citizenship, applicants may be asked to include biometric information in their application. Applicants need to give biometrics if they haven’t given biometrics in the last 10 years.
